The answer is 16 units
An easy way to find the perimeter is remembering the formula of a+b+c.
So in this case, you count how many units each line of the triangle it covers. 4+6+6= 16

Some people use credit to pay for items instead of just using cash so they do not have to carry money around and so it is easier. ... It is preferable to receive a low interest rate so you do not have to pay high amounts. Sometimes, lenders allow or require a down payment before they extend you the loan.

To find the length of the rectangle, you need to first do 20 x 2 = 40 because when you finding the perimeter you have to do W + L + W + L = P (or Wx2 + Lx2 = P). You then subtract 40 from 68 (68 - 40) where you get 28 left. you then just divide 28/2 and you get 14. I may be way off but that's how I learned it.
